1. Broken Panes

It is essential to repair your double-pane windows as soon as they're damaged or broken. In contrast to single-pane windows, which offer only a small amount of insulation against the elements, double pane windows can help protect your home from the elements and help you save on energy costs. The air pocket that exists between the two sheets aids to reduce condensation, and the growth of mold or mildew in your home.

Based on the severity of the damage and if one or both panes are damaged, it may be possible to replace the glass instead of the entire window. This is typically less expensive and can be done if the frame and other parts of the window are in good shape. A professional glazier will be able to advise on this.

If both panes of the window are damaged or damaged, it's likely that replacing the entire window will be necessary. This is because both panes need to be replaced to maintain the airtight seal that is essential to ensure energy efficiency. This can be expensive but it is generally cheaper than the alternative of boarding up the window until a replacement is able to be ordered and installed.

The cost of repairing or replacing a damaged window will vary based on the size and shape of the window as well as the material used in the frame. A more elaborate or larger designed window, for instance one with a more elaborate design, will cost more money to fix than a standard window. In addition, a window that is situated on the second floor will be more difficult to access, and thus more costly to repair than a first-floor window.

Double pane windows are made to offer better insulation against cold and hot weather. This will significantly reduce your energy costs. If the seals become damaged or break down However, they may lose their effectiveness and begin to leak air, which results in higher heating and cooling costs. Professionals can repair or replace the IGU (insulated unit) in double pane windows, but will also have to ensure whether the frame is in good shape.

2. Cracked Panes

Double glazing is a green solution for homes. The window is composed of two panes, window repairs near me which are separated by a space of air and filled with insulating gas. If properly maintained by a glazier or installer the type of window can last for 25-30 years. In this time, signs such as visible damage, condensation and draughts may indicate that it's time repair or replace the windows.

Double-glazed windows are the most likely to have a cracked pane of glass. A professional glazier is capable of providing a temporary solution using an adhesive to fill in the cracks between the glass. It is usually a kind of putty or special tape that preserves the glass from further breaking or cracking. This temporary fix will stop the loss of the important insulating gas in the window. It should be completed as soon as possible.

Double-paned windows that are broken are more than just a nuisance to the eye. It can also decrease the efficiency of your home. The broken glass lets heat pass through the window, which causes your AC and furnace to work harder to keep your home warm. This inefficiency can lead to more expensive energy bills and unneeded wear and tear on your heating and cooling systems.

Fortunately, the majority of double pane windows are made of toughened glass that is more difficult to break than single pane windows. They are susceptible to damage due to weather conditions, as well as other factors like shifting of a house or pressure washing frames. Insulated window seals, or IGUs, may also degrade over time due to paint bleeding or moisture and humidity and expansion and contraction of the glass panes as temperatures change.

In most situations, it is best to employ an experienced window replacement company or glazier for the work. A professional will have the right tools and know-how to take down and replace a double-pane safely. They can help you determine what the cause of the damage is and the best course of action you should take for your particular situation.

3. Seals

The window seals keep the air gap between triple and double pane windows in place. If they break the window gets cloudy and loses its insulation. This is a frequent issue that can occur due to various reasons. In the majority of cases it is caused by changes in the weather and exposure to cold or hot that cause seals to expand and contract slightly. The seal can become compromised or break down over time because of this constant motion.

A professional window repair service is the best way to fix a broken seal. A window repair specialist can take the damaged window and then clean and Window repairs Near me replace the seal before reinstalling the pane. They will also reseal the area around the window to prevent it from becoming foggy in the future. This is a great solution for homeowners of all ages and can help them save money on their energy bills.

However it is crucial to remember that replacing windows might be the best option if the windows are old and inefficient. The reason is that newer windows can provide much more insulation than single-pane windows. The replacement of windows can increase a home's energy efficiency by up to 30% and reduce on heating and cooling costs.

A window replacement is a more costly option than a window repair however it can be worth the investment in the long term. Replacement windows can also boost the value of a house and increase appearance. The process can also be completed quickly without causing any inconvenience to the owner of the property.

Some homeowners would like to repair their double-glazed windows themselves particularly when the warranty is still valid. This is a job that should be left to professionals as it requires specialized tools, and understanding of glass and window technology. It is also essential to use the appropriate safety equipment to prevent injury to the body or damage to the frame of the window.

Window repairs are usually less expensive than replacing the entire unit, but it is important to seek advice from a professional prior to doing any work on your own. This will ensure that the work is done correctly and any issues are addressed prior to them becoming larger problems.

4. Water Leaks

If you see water dripping from the window's top or sides, the frame might not be fitting properly to the glass panes. This issue occurs when windows are older or that have been put in the wrong way. This kind of leak can be fixed with a simple layer of caulking.

A leak in the bottom of your windows could be a serious problem. This could mean that the gas seal between the panes is degrading and rain is getting into your home. If this is the case, it's likely time to replace your double glazing near me-glazed windows to improve the efficiency of your home's energy usage.

Another reason that can cause leaks in windows is defective flashing. Flashing is a securing device that's installed around the exterior of your window frame to stop water from getting in through cracks or gaps. If the flashing is nailed in the wrong way or is not present altogether, water can easily pass through these gaps and cause damage to the window as well as your home.

To pinpoint the source of a leaky window it is recommended to examine the exterior and interior of your home. To pinpoint the location of the leak look for peeling or stains on the ceiling and walls. Examine the gutters and roof for any damage that could be causing the water to collect near your windows.

Also, you must clean any holes that have become blocked at the bottom of your frames. They are designed to let condensation to drain out rather than build up and drip onto the window. It is recommended to contact a professional to assess and repair or replace a window when you notice that one is leaking.
